The current GW1000 driver will speak to a GW2000 and should return all obs 
except for WS90 rain and WS90 signal/battery states. I am working on the 
v0.5.0 driver but the behaviour of the GW2000 API with various combinations 
of the 'traditional' and 'piezo' rain gauges (Ecowitt's terms) is not very 
clearly defined. I will likely need some assistance from GW2000 users with 
various rain gauge combinations to tie this down. WS90 signal and battery 
states are already working in the v0.5.0 driver.
